@Flamebird23 I donā€™t think very many actors ever read much in the way of source material, except to the extent that they were genuine fans as kids/teens, and even those that claim they ā€˜readā€™ comics as kids, it can become fairly apparent if you dig through their interviews that this is absolutely not true.

And I think fans shouldnā€™t be surprised by this or be saddened by this. Itā€™s the job of the screen writer to do a good adaptation and the job of the director to make sure the actor is bringing those ideas onto the screen. To the extent that Ezra is playing an autistic version of Wally or was written as a Peter Parker analog, that is on the writers and producers, as well as how the Cult Leader and Whedon directed him; likewise with Grant on the DCW Flash, more of the problem can be laid on the show runners, than on him, although I never felt like they were trying to make him Wally - just that they nerfed him far too much, spent way too much energy with the Star Kids and unnecessarily turned a solo hero into some form of Scooby gang.
